Oh what a day I've had.  Today Insane Bank Corp (my day-job employer)
upgraded their Windows desktop encryption software.  *Every*
directory on every computer is now blessed with a "Desktop.ini" file.
Git of course loves this concept:

 $ git for-each-ref >/dev/null && echo yes
 error: refs/Desktop.ini points nowhere!
 error: refs/heads/Desktop.ini points nowhere!
 yes

Fortunately for-each-ref allows corrupt refs to exist in the ref
namespace.  So until Git is properly patched we are at least able
to ignore these error messages.

 Our corporate security goons are unable to fathom why having
 "Desktop.ini" shoved into every directory of every filesystem may
 cause problems for some applications.  Especially those who may
 attempt to read every file in a given directory.

 git-compat-util.h |   13 +++++++++++++
 1 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)

diff --git a/git-compat-util.h b/git-compat-util.h
index ca0a597..ca875c7 100644
--- a/git-compat-util.h
+++ b/git-compat-util.h
@@ -172,6 +172,19 @@ extern uintmax_t gitstrtoumax(const char *, char **, int);
 extern const char *githstrerror(int herror);
 #endif
 
+#ifdef WORK_FOR_INSANE_BANK_CORP
+static inline struct dirent *gitreaddir(DIR *dirp)
+{
+	struct dirent *r;
+	while ((r = readdir(dirp))) {
+		if (!strcasecmp(r->d_name, "Desktop.ini"))
+			continue;
+	}
+	return r;
+}
+#define readdir gitreaddir
+#endif
+
 extern void release_pack_memory(size_t, int);
 
 static inline char* xstrdup(const char *str)
